All the enzymes in your body work best at different pHs. For example, the protease made in your stomach works best at a pH of 2 which is why the hydrocloric acid in your stomach is the best condition for the enzymes.
But the protease made in your pancreas works best at pH 7 or 8.
Your body made a variety of different chemicals which help our enzymes work best.
Your stomach:
In the stomach there are around 35 million glands in your lining secreting enzymes to digest proteins (protease). These enzymes work best in a acid pH, so your stomach also secretes a concentrated solution of hydrochloric acid from the same glands. Around 3 litres a day to be exact.
